Information Technology SectorThe graduates of Sector of INFORMATION TECHNOLOGY

of EPAL will have the ability to provide technical support to an information system (hardware-software) by applying the new technologies.

Information Technology SectorSystem Support , PC Applications and Networks

Prospective employment :

A) Technical Support of IT Systems B) Sales Of Products and services of Information technology

in the private or public sector.More specifically:

1. In Public Enterprises and Organisations, Administration, Education and Training that use products and services of Information technology. 2. In Enterprises that manufacture or support products of Information technology. 3. In Enterprises that sell product and services of IT

Entry Examsto Universities or Technological Institutes

Students can take Exams in six (6) subjects onnationwide scale and continue their studies in aUniversity or a Technological Institute. The subjectsvary according to their sector.

ExhibitionStudents’ Projects 1st EPAL

During the first days of May each year students from all the EPAL of the prefecture present their projects according to their Technical and Vocational specialty in an exhibition organised by our school. The Exhibition is visited by students from all the high schools of the prefecture .
